交流电凝聚技术及其在油田污水处理方面的应用研究

Application of Alternating Current Electrocoagulation Technology to Waste Water Treatment in Oil Fields

【摘要】 交流电凝聚(ACE)技术能有效地从稳定的悬浮液和乳浊液中凝聚并分离出固相、重金属和油。电压缩和电絮凝促进凝结、快速沉淀及脱水,且不使用昂贵的高分子电解质和化学药品,也不需使用复杂且易于被超细微粒堵塞的过滤系统。木文介绍了ACE技术的初步原理及其在国外油田污水处理方面的应用,并与传统的污水净化方法进行了比较。

【Abstract】 Alternating current electrocoagujation(ACE) technology can effectively coagulate and separate the stable suspending liquid and emulsion into solids,heavy metals and oil.Electrostriction and electrocoagulation promote condensation,rapid precipitation and dewatering so as to avoid using costly macromolecular electrolyte and chemicals.Besides,it is not necessary to use any complicated filtering system which is susceptible to plugging by ultramicro particles.This paper introduces the preliminary principle of ACE technology and its application to sewage treatment in foreign oil fields and has also made a comparison between this and the traditional sewage purification.
